Changes to the Aegon JPMorgan Global Dynamic All Countries (BLK) fund

This is a Aegon TargetPlan update
On 10 April 2019, the additional expenses for the Aegon JPMorgan Global Dynamic All Countries (BLK) fund reduced by 0.2% across all share classes available via the Aegon TargetPlan fund range.
At this time, the underlying fund manager, JP Morgan Asset Management (UK) Limited, also changed the name of the underlying fund.
- We implemented the additional expenses reduction on 10 April 2019
- and updated the Aegon TargetPlan fund name on 3 February 2020.
The name change in more detail:
Old fund name before 3 February 2020 | New fund name after 3 February 2020 |
---|---|
Aegon JPMorgan Global Dynamic All Countries (BLK) fund | Aegon JPMorgan Life Global Equity All Countries (BLK) fund |
Source: Aegon UK
Why we’ve changed the fund name
The underlying fund manager, JP Morgan Asset Management (UK) Limited, decided to change the fund name to better reflect how the fund is managed. As a result, they believed that using ‘Dynamic’ in the title was no longer representative of the way the fund is managed and replaced it with ‘Equity’.
To ensure consistency for our customers, we’ve also changed our fund name to match that of the underlying fund.
Our literature has been updated to reflect these changes, but investors may notice both the old and new information in use for a time.
